How to prepare for a job interview at Staffline Branches
✨Show Your Leadership Skills
As a Line Leader, demonstrating your leadership abilities is crucial. Be prepared to share examples of how you've successfully led a team in the past, highlighting your communication and problem-solving skills.
✨Understand the Production Process
Familiarise yourself with the chilled food production process. Research the company’s products and be ready to discuss how you can contribute to improving efficiency and quality on the production line.
✨Emphasise Safety Awareness
Safety is paramount in a production environment. Be sure to discuss your understanding of safety protocols and how you have implemented or adhered to them in previous roles.
✨Prepare Questions for the Interviewers
Having insightful questions ready shows your interest in the role and the company. Ask about the team dynamics, challenges they face, and opportunities for growth within the company.
